树莓派

无显示器无路由器无键盘无鼠标,仅靠网线直连笔记本用最简单配置玩转树莓派

こ雲淡風輕ζ 提交于 2019-11-26 14:25:50
出差在外,想折腾树莓派耍下,但是不记得树莓派的ip地址,当然可以用扫描工具扫下,比如advanced ip scanner。但是嫌麻烦还是想折腾下仅靠网线直连笔记本用最简单配置玩转树莓派。 用网线直连电脑,不经过路由器。这个方法最大的特点用最少的工具玩树莓派。 准备工作,烧Raspbian系统到SD卡。刚官网看了下有新的系统下载,http://www.raspberrypi.org/downloads/,重新下了了下2014-01-07那个1.3.4版本的。然后格式化SD卡,FAT格式。我用win7系统,选的Win32DiskImager烧下。如果linux系统 的,用dd工具,细节自己google。 一、材料:树莓派一部、网线一根,笔记本电脑一台。 1、树莓派:带供电系统和烧好Raspbian系统的SD卡,供电用手机的充电线用笔记本的usb供电 2、网线:交叉或直连; 3、笔记本电脑:双网卡,现在应该都是这个配置的。 二、操作步骤。 1、连线。 树莓派接好供电线; 将网线一端接到树莓派,另一端接到笔记本。 2、共享互联网。 如果现在笔记本已经通过WIFI连接到互联网,可以将无线网卡的互联网资源共享给本地连接。以win7系统为例,开始——控制面板——网络和 Internet——网络和共享中心——查看网络状态和任务——更改适配器设置,找到无线网络连接右键“属性”,在共享选项卡上选中

使用qemu虚拟机运行树莓派(linux kernel 4.9)

 ̄綄美尐妖づ 提交于 2019-11-26 06:17:05
  2018年5月8日更新, https://github.com/dhruvvyas90/qemu-rpi-kernel 的项目已经更新,现已支持4.9内核的编译,大家可以参考编译。   同时按照本文操作也可以将树莓派虚拟起来,不过会遇到模块加载错误,导致网卡等驱动安装失败。如果用dhruvvyas90的方法重新编译内核就不会有这个问题,但是经过dhruvvyas90编译后的内核能否从新打包备份还原至树莓派上还存疑。   这篇博客起自于年前的一个想法,当时刚得到一个树莓派zero老版,因为没有Wi-Fi模块导致一些依赖安装特别困难,就想到能否用虚拟机来运行树莓派系统,然后通过镜像导出再写入到zero中,这样也能省去一些调试的麻烦,但是关于qemu虚拟树莓派的文章大都指向一个github项目就是 dhruvvyas90 的一个工程。之前适用于qemu的树莓派内核共享网站关闭,dhruvvyas90辛苦整理出了qemu启动树莓派的内核文件以及编译内核的脚本,但该工程停止更新到了kernel-qemu-4.4.34-jessie,同时在实际的使用中发现,编译脚本只适用于linux 4.4及以下的内核编译,若编译linux 4.5及以上的内核时该脚本均会出现编译错误,这个错误困扰了我好几个月终于整理出了一套简单的qemu虚拟树莓派的方法。 一、安装qemu: 1、依赖安装:

基于树莓派(Raspberry Pi)平台的MQ-2烟雾报警系统实现(一)

此生再无相见时 提交于 2019-11-26 02:11:10
一、前期准备 达成目标:   利用Rapberry Pi 驱动MQ-2烟雾报警模块,对信息进行采集和提取。 1. 准备树莓派(Raspberry Pi)一个 2. MQ-2有害气体检测模块 3. 杜邦线若干 4. SD卡一张以及一个读卡器 二、各个器件介绍 1.树莓派(Raspberry Pi)   Raspberry Pi是一个英国小型组织慈善组织The Raspberry Pi Foundation发行的一款针对电脑业余爱好者,学生,以及小型企业等用户的迷你电脑,预装的是Linux操作系统,体积非常小巧,在最新款的Raspberry Pi 3 Model B,搭载了高通的ARMv8的高性能CUP,并且包含1GB RAM,引脚数上升到40个。 较上一代的优点: 1.首先处理器是新一代四核心Broadcom BCM2837 64位ARMv8 处理器,并且处理器速度最高可达1.2GHz,必要时还可以超频。</font> 2.第二是新添加了板载BCM43143 WiFi芯片,无需WiFi网络适配器。 Raspberry Pi官网:https://www.raspberrypi.org/ 2.MQ-2有害气体检测模块   这是一款广泛应用于家庭和工厂的气体泄漏检测装置,适用于液化气、甲烷、丙烷、丁烷、酒精、氢气、烟雾等有害气体的检测。 有四个引脚: VCC:输入5V正极电流 GND